The photoinduced toxicity of two polycyclic aromatic hydrocarbons (PAHs), retene (RET) and pyrene (PYR), to the eleutheroembryos of whitefish and northern pike was studied. Fish were exposed to three concentrations of RET and PYR, and irradiated with ultraviolet radiation (UVR) or visible light for 3 h on two consecutive days. UVR covered the absorption maxima of RET and PYR at UVB and UVA, the daily UVR doses were 30 and 28 kJ m−2, respectively. After 72 h, mortality and behavioral abnormalities were observed. ABSTRACT Steatocystoma is a rare, benign cyst that mostly originates from a dermal sebaceous gland. It can be divided into steatocystoma multiplex—with multiple locations—and steatocystoma simplex occurring at a single site. The lesion is mostly located on the skin but can be found on other locations as well. This is the first case report of steatocystoma simplex that was found in the palate of a 37-year-old male. After resection with small safety margins and local wound dressing, no recurrence was detected during a follow-up of 1.5 years.

A clinical trial on the autofluorescence imaging of skin lesions comprising 16 dermatologically confirmed pigmented nevi, 15 seborrheic keratosis, 2 dysplastic nevi, histologically confirmed 17 basal cell carcinomas and 1 melanoma was performed. The autofluorescence spatial properties of the skin lesions were acquired by smartphone RGB camera under 405 nm LED excitation. The diagnostic criterion is based on the calculation of the mean autofluorescence intensity of the examined lesion in the spectral range of 515 nm–700 nm. The comparative distribution and coexistence of chromogranin A (CGA)-, serotonin (5-hydroxytryptamine; 5-HT)- and pancreastatin (PST)-like immunoreactivity in endocrine-like cells of the human anal canal was investigated by light-microscopic immunocytochemistry. The largest population of colorectal endocrine-like cells consisted of CGA-immunoreactive (ir) cells, followed by the 5-HT-ir and PST-ir cell population. In the anal transitional zone (ATZ), CGA- and 5-HT-immunoreactivity was equally distributed; ir-PST was confined to a smaller endocrine-like cell population.
